Welcome, plugin authors, to the Fernwhistle Scheduler SDK. Your plugin receives a watering window object with soil-moisture thresholds, species profiles, and a dry-run flag; always honor the dry-run flag before actuating any valve integration. Rate limits are enforced per greenhouse zone, and retries must use exponential backoff to avoid flooding the queue. Sandbox credentials rotate weekly. If you lose access to the sandbox keyring, restore it with the recovery passphrase that follows.

unlock words, fafop-hawep: briwyn-oliix-sorox

Insurance Renewal — Restricted Wiki (Managers Only)

Company: Delverton Marine Holdings

This page records the status of the group policy renewal for board reference. Our broker has tabled terms from three underwriters; premiums rise between 8% and 14%, reflecting last year's hull claim at Stonely Quay. Coverage limits remain unchanged, though the flood excess increases materially. A full comparison schedule has been circulated separately. The board should note the strategic consideration recorded immediately below.

board note of fahif-yahog: Gross margin on Wenath came in at 10 percent against a plan of 5 percent. Only 3 of the 100 pilot accounts renewed Wenath, so a churn review is set for July 15.

## Auth

BigDiff (our diff viewer for huge files) won't render anything until it can talk to the ChunkStore service, so if you're on call and seeing blank panes, auth is the first suspect. Tokens are short-lived and minted automatically; you shouldn't need to touch them. The one exception is the internal indexing hook, which still uses a static key. That key is pasted right below.

app token of bawep-hafog = kto7_vwrmnlx

**Intern Cohort Arrival — Reception Guidance**

On Monday morning, reception at Caldermist House will welcome fourteen interns from the Larkspun Programme. Please check each name against the arrivals list, issue an orange lanyard, and direct them to the Willow Room for induction at 09:30. Permanent badges will not be ready until Wednesday, so interns must be buzzed through manually. To release the inner lobby doors for escorted groups, use the code below.

staff pass of kawip-hawef = bdg-QLP-2